Estonia - Female Pre-Primary Education School Age Population
Since 2014, Estonia Female Pre-Primary Education School Age Population was up 0.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 150 among other countries in Female Pre-Primary Education School Age Population at 31,589 Persons. Estonia is overtaken by Bahrain, which was number 149 at 31,954 Persons and is followed by Slovenia with 31,290 Persons. India lead the ranking with 36,574,060.11 Persons in 2019, an increase of 0.3% versus 2018. China, Nigeria and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ine witnessed the best average annual growth at +19.8% per year, while Ecuador witnessed the worst performance at -10.5% per year.
